Stem cells are broadly categorized into embryonic, Grownup, and induced pluripotent stem cells (iPSCs). Embryonic stem cells, derived from early-phase embryos, are pluripotent, that means they could build into practically any cell key in your body. Adult stem cells, located in tissues like bone marrow or Fats, are usually multipotent, with a more limited differentiation potential. iPSCs, made by reprogramming adult cells to an embryonic-like point out, Blend versatility with moral strengths, averting the controversies linked to embryonic stem cells. This diversity allows scientists to tailor therapies to particular medical desires.
The programs of stem mobile therapy are extensive. In regenerative medicine, stem cells are now being explored to restore weakened tissues and organs. By way of example, in cardiac care, stem cells can most likely regenerate heart muscle mass broken by coronary heart assaults. In neurology, they provide assure for situations like Parkinson’s sickness, in which dopaminergic neurons derived from stem cells could replace dropped cells. Orthopedic purposes contain regenerating cartilage for arthritis people, although in diabetic issues, stem mobile-derived beta cells could restore insulin manufacturing. These illustrations only scratch the surface of what’s achievable as investigate continues to evolve.
